Exploring the Essence of "Antoinette at Her Dresser" by Mary Cassatt

Captivating Portraiture: The Artistic Vision of Mary Cassatt

Mary Cassatt: A Pioneer of Impressionism

Mary Cassatt stands out as a leading figure in the Impressionist movement. Born in 1844 in Pennsylvania, she broke barriers in a male-dominated art world. Cassatt's unique perspective as a woman artist allowed her to capture intimate moments of women's lives, making her work both relatable and revolutionary. Her dedication to portraying the female experience has left a lasting impact on art history.

Feminine Perspective in Art: The Role of Women in Cassatt's Work

In "Antoinette at Her Dresser," Cassatt emphasizes the feminine experience through her subject, Antoinette. This painting reflects the daily rituals of women in the late 19th century, showcasing their beauty and self-care. Cassatt's focus on women's lives challenges traditional gender roles and highlights the importance of female identity in art.

Historical Context: The Influence of the Late 19th Century

Art Movements: The Shift Towards Modernism

The late 19th century marked a significant shift in art, moving towards modernism. Artists began to explore new techniques and subjects, breaking away from traditional forms. Cassatt's work exemplifies this transition, as she embraced Impressionism while also paving the way for future artistic movements.

Women in Society: The Changing Roles and Expectations

During this period, women's roles were evolving. The suffrage movement was gaining momentum, and women began to assert their independence. Cassatt's focus on women's lives in her art reflects these changing societal norms, highlighting the importance of female empowerment and self-expression.

Legacy of Mary Cassatt: Impact on Future Generations of Artists

Influence on Feminist Art Movements

Mary Cassatt's work has significantly influenced feminist art movements. Her focus on women's experiences and perspectives paved the way for future female artists to explore similar themes. Cassatt's legacy continues to inspire artists to challenge societal norms and celebrate women's voices in art.

Recognition and Exhibitions: Celebrating Cassatt's Contributions

Cassatt's contributions to art have been recognized through numerous exhibitions and retrospectives. Her work is celebrated in major museums worldwide, including the Metropolitan Museum of Art and the Musée d'Orsay. These exhibitions highlight her importance in art history and her role as a trailblazer for women artists.
